Endace, a global leader in packet capture solutions, has announced a strategic partnership with Immersive, a frontrunner in people-centered cybersecurity training. This collaboration aims to elevate the preparedness of Security Operations Center (SOC) teams by fusing forensic packet analysis with immersive, hands-on training simulations.
The joint initiative integrates Endace’s robust packet capture technology, EndaceProbe, with Immersive’s dynamic cybersecurity training environment. This powerful combination enables security teams to sharpen their skills, accelerate threat detection, and improve incident response times through realistic training experiences.

Unlike traditional training methods, this solution allows analysts to engage directly with tools used in live network environments. Within minutes of starting a scenario, trainees are immersed in situations where they must detect, analyze, and respond to threats using EndaceProbe. The goal: to simulate real-world attacks in a safe, controlled environment, helping teams build muscle memory for high-pressure situations.
“Partnering with Immersive allows us to take cyber preparedness to the next level,” said Cary Wright, VP of Product Management at Endace. “SOC teams gain tremendous value from practicing on the same tools they use every day, in scenarios that reflect the threats they’re likely to encounter. It’s a game-changer for building resilience.”
Key Advantages of the Collaboration:
Enhanced Cyber Readiness: Live, simulated cyberattacks integrated with continuous packet forensics help teams build real-time detection and response capabilities.

Skills Under Pressure: Test SOC team reactions to simulated high-stress incidents, ensuring better preparedness in real situations.
Performance Visibility: Leverage metrics and forensic data to evaluate team proficiency, uncover skill gaps, and drive continuous improvement.
Faster Response Times: Equip teams with deep familiarity in using forensic tools like EndaceProbe to accelerate threat resolution.
Gamified Learning: Realistic labs and threat exercises make training engaging while reinforcing technical capabilities.
Benchmarking: Measure performance against industry peers to guide broader cyber resilience strategies.
“Today’s evolving cyber landscape demands more than theoretical knowledge,” said Thanos Karpouzis, CTO at Immersive. “With EndaceProbe now part of our training platform, we’re giving teams hands-on exposure to enterprise-grade packet capture systems. This not only builds confidence but enables them to adapt faster and respond with greater accuracy when real threats emerge.”
The partnership between Endace and Immersive marks a significant step forward in preparing cybersecurity professionals for the complexities of modern threats. By merging data-driven packet visibility with dynamic simulation environments, organizations now have the tools to ensure their cyber teams are always ready for the next challenge.
